Safe indoors

Bio-fires can be used indoors much more safely than real fires since they don't release smoke, ash, or carcinogenic fumes. Bio-fires don't create carbon monoxide, which can be harmful if inhaled. The bio-ethanol fuel they use is flammable however, and you should be extremely careful when handling the burner and refuelling your fire. The fuel should only be added after the burner has been switched off and your fire has been cooled. Any spills must be cleaned up immediately.

Bio-ethanol flame effect fires are safe to use but should be kept away from objects that are combustible, such as pillows, curtains and blankets. It is not recommended to place them close to anything that could catch fire. Keep all flammable items away from the fires that cause flames by at minimum 10 feet. The bioethanol fuel must be stored in a location that is dry and secure so that pets or children are unable to access it.
